About the role

Provide in-home placement and daily living support for adults with intellectual and developmental disabilities. Responsibilities include personal care, medication administration, and facilitating community integration and social activities.

Sample Supports is actively seeking an energetic and professional Host Home Provider in Boulder County and surrounding areas. Host Home Providers offer an in-home placement to adults with disabilities of varying needs, allowing each person to live in their own communities with the support they need to stay as independent as possible.

This position will serves individuals with behavioral needs, mental health needs, medical needs, and daily support needs. The individuals may need support in general activities of daily living, social and emotional regulation, plus encouragement to participate in needed appointments and services.

Host Home Providers are contractors of Sample Supports and receive competitive payments for the difficulty of care required for the person.

Sample Supports provides comprehensive general training as well as specific training tailored to the individual in care. Our residential team is on-call 24/7 and is there to support you if any needs come up during the placement. You become a part of our integrated care team, and we aim to create placements that fully integrate into both your home and the greater community.

Sample Supports will provide

General training on caregiving and the needs of individuals with disabilities Trauma-informed and social emotional care responses First-aid, CPR, and general safety trainings for all members of the household Person-centered training based on the person in care Integrated and adaptive behavior support plans Crisis intervention and emergency response planning 24/7 on-call support Support team of expert clinicians to provide in-home and community-based training as needed Up to 30 hours/week of supplemental programming for the individual if needed Trained respite providers and proactive respite scheduling support

Provider duties and responsibilities

Provide personal assistance, social and emotional support, and other personal care to adults with intellectual and developmental disabilities in a home and community environment Support with activities of daily living including shopping and meal preparation, personal care/hygiene routines, and general in-home support tasks as needed Community activities based on the needs of the individual – can create a unique activity plan together for their respite stay Transportation services as needed – may include transportation to/from scheduled activities and appointments Complete documentation for services provided Medication administration and support as needed

We have skilled providers from a variety of professional and personal backgrounds – we are ultimately looking for people who are: Passionate about actively working to improve the lives of persons with disabilities Open to providing behavioral support as needed in an effective, calm, and caring manner Desire to work closely within a community network of family members, individuals in services, and agencies Willing to create a flexible, adaptive, and supportive environment to offer a home to an individual in need

Requirements

for the contract: Must be at least 21 years old Must have a GED or diploma Must have dependable and reliable transportation with the ability to safely transport Must have a valid driver's license Must be able to pass background check Must have appropriate living environment with at least one available bedroom Preferred knowledge and understanding of developmental disabilities, mental health, and trauma Must be competent and willing to perform Non-Violent Crisis Intervention physical managements as trained Job responsibilities include reporting any suspected maltreatment, abuse, neglect, or exploitation of an at-risk individual (M/A/N/E). Each position is considered a mandatory reporter

Preferred

Non smoking and healthy lifestyle No young children and minimal number of pets, if any Maintain open communication with individuals guardians Fiscally responsible CNA, LPN, or RN

Compensation varies depending on the level of support the individual needs. This placement will be compensated based on the current difficulty of care rates. Supplemental room and board payments may also be provided at up to $797/month.
